Transaction 660a509110068fc45b1570dbc42f139831877db8776e083cedfdfc25f800b5c8
1 Input
1 Output
-
660a509110068fc45b1570dbc42f139831877db8776e083cedfdfc25f800b5c8:0
- value
- 1262432
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e831730e8e35874bf686de67a672e355fd81f8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 18A8kJCvsC6x9DTD6WjEDfzLo8WUXHvENw